DealerStandard ListingRare 1976 GMC Sierra 1500 “Royal Sierra” pickup truck. Cousin truck to the Chevy Bonanza, this is an end of year package that featured option bundling, along with unique seats, trim, and emblems. Especially with attractive colors like this Yuba Gold & White combination, a Royal Sierra is a terrific way to stand out at a local show. 99.9% rust free, with the 3 MINOR spots showing behind the rear wheel wells, and in front of the driver’s lower fender. Just an absolutely gorgeous, honest truck.
This is a 77,500 mile survivor with what appears to be all original paint. Well-optioned “C” level pickup with a 350, AC, tilt, tinted glass, gauges, and others listed on the SPID. Excellent provenance accompanies this truck as well, including a build sheet, warranty book, decades of registation cards, and many receipts. Notice all the original firewall marks, GM hoses, clamps, and tags on suspension pieces. The undercarriage is just as clean as the rest of the truck, and has been treated with a paraffin wax spray called Boeshield T-9 to keep it preserved. No dumb undercoating materials, just a clear, removeable spray to preserve what’s there.
This pickup starts, runs, accelerates, and drives straight and smooth at highway speeds of 65-70. Cruise it as it sits, and sort out some leaks, replace some rubber components, etc, as you go.
